A power-up is a temporary (and sometimes permanent) bonus a player can collect or trigger to gain an advantage in a video game. It’s designed to change how you move, attack, defend, or score—often making you stronger, faster, safer, or more capable for a short window of time.
Most power-ups are earned by picking up an item, opening a chest, defeating an enemy, completing an objective, or hitting a specific in-game trigger. Once activated, the effect might last a few seconds, a full level, or until you take damage. Some games show a timer, glowing aura, or special sound to signal the boost is active.
Power-ups come in many forms, but a few show up across genres:
Offense boosts: Increased damage, rapid-fire shots, elemental attacks, critical-hit bonuses, or temporary “ultimate” weapons.
Defense boosts: Shields, invincibility frames, damage reduction, extra armor, or a free “revive.”
Mobility boosts: Speed boosts, double jumps, dashes, grappling hooks, flight, or underwater breathing.
Resource boosts: Restoring health, ammo, mana/energy, or granting extra lives and points multipliers.
Power-ups add momentum and variety. They reward exploration, create comeback opportunities, and encourage strategic decisions—like saving a boost for a boss fight or using it immediately to survive a tough encounter. They also help balance pacing by giving players brief spikes of power between more challenging moments.
A quick way to tell the difference: power-ups are usually temporary and situational, while upgrades are often permanent improvements you keep for the rest of the game (or run). Some games blend the two by offering power-ups that stack or evolve into longer-lasting abilities.

A power-up is a collectible or trigger that grants an effect, while a buff is the effect itself (like boosted speed or defense). In many games, picking up a power-up gives your character a buff for a set duration.
